So, 'Un, deux, trois' is this peculiar gem from 2017 that somehow flies under the radar. It has this gritty, almost raw atmosphere, stemming from Florian's and Julie's morally ambiguous escapades after a botched bank heist. The pacing keeps you on your toes, with a mix of tension and dark humor. Their scams to secure bank loans are just as much about desperation as they are about intimacy, which adds depth. The performances are pretty engaging, especially in how they navigate their chaotic lives. It’s not your typical heist film; there's something more introspective lurking beneath the surface, making it stand out in a crowded genre.
